QSynergy Makes Multi-System Control Easier and Prettier
Awhile back I posted about how to Turn You Laptop into An Additional Monitor with Synergy. QSynergy adds a simplified graphical interface onto the original Synergy along with some bonus features and bug fixes.
Best of all, QSynergy is a free download for Windows, Mac, and Linux systems.

Turn Your Laptop into An Additional Monitor
Easily add additional work space to your computing setup by adding your laptop as another monitor. The problem with the traditional approach of using a laptop as an additional monitor is that laptops, in their open position take up a lot of desk space. Laptops screens also sit below the eye line and aren’t very conducive for long use. Kill two birds with one stone and purchase a study stand. For under ten dollars you can stand your laptop up on your desk almost completely open and position it next to your other monitor(s). How do I share my keyboard and mouse between computers?
